Tanzania - Import of Rosin and Resin Acids
Since 2013, Tanzania Import of Rosin and Resin Acids decreased by 47.2% year on year. At $12,630.52 in 2018, the country was number 99 comparing other countries in Import of Rosin and Resin Acids. Tanzania is overtaken by Burkina Faso, which was number 98 at $14,950.82 and is followed by Cameroon with $9,492. China ranked the highest with $87,160,498.2 in 2019, that is a growth of 3.4% compared to 2018. Portugal, India and Japan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Malta witnessed the best average annual growth at +725.9% per year, while Rwanda was the worst growing country at -70.3% per year.
